The government has prepared amendments to the rules to guarantee that the limits of budget expenditure for the financing of universal services are compatible between 2026 and 2027 with EU requirements.
According to the Ministry of State Assets, after the amendment of the Act, backing will be provided to support the unchangeable provision of postal services throughout the country.
Significant support for Polish Post
The Government Work Programming squad entered a draft amendment of the Postal Law Act (UD225) on the list of government works. The draft envisages adjusting the limits of the state budget expenditure for financing the net cost of universal service obligations in the years 2026 and 2027, as set out in Article 5(1)(5) and (6) of the Postal Law Amendment, to the amounts indicated in the European Commission Decision of 15 November 2024. This means crucial support for the Polish Post Office:
- PLN 997 000 000,00 in 2026;
- 960 000 000,00 PLN in 2027.
The Act will enter into force on 1 January 2026.
The amendment will let Poczta Polska to fulfil the work to supply universal services in a unchangeable and consistent manner, and will guarantee the safety of citizens utilizing these services.
